About This Audiobook
Dive into the fascinating, lesser-known roots of America’s air dominance in 'The Dream of Civilized Warfare' by Linda R. Robertson, narrated with precision and gravity by Jim Woods. This meticulously researched historical exploration uncovers how World War I shaped our nation’s military culture and technological advancements. Through vivid storytelling and well-crafted narrative, the audiobook delves into the complex interplay between politics, technology, and public perception that led to America's pivotal role in modern warfare.
